Porsche 918 Spotting!!!

Heading north on 684 between Harrison and (of course) Greenwich yesterday. Teenage kid driving it, with father in passenger seat? Car had in transit plates. Gave a thumbs up and the kid gave me a nod. moving pics are tough :(


